52188313136 has 20 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 101201835912. Its totient is φ = 26071710336.
The previous prime is 52188313069. The next prime is 52188313169. The reversal of 52188313136 is 63131388125.
It is a hoax number, since the sum of its digits (41) coincides with the sum of the digits of its distinct prime factors.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 52188313093 and 52188313102.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 1383701 + ... + 1420916.
Almost surely, 252188313136 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
52188313136 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(49013522776).
52188313136 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
52188313136 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 2805788 (or 2805782 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its digits is 103680, while the sum is 41.
